7.3 MVI46-103M
Status Data Area
This section contains a listing of the data contained in the MVI46-103M status
data object, configuration error word and module error codes.
7.3.1 MVI46-IEC
60870-5-103
Master Communication
Module Error/Status Data Format
Offset Parameter Description
4000 Scan
Count This status value contains a counter incremented on each scan of the
module's main loop.
4001 to
4002
Product Name
This two-word data area contains the text values representing the
product name. These words contain the text 'I3M4' for the MVI46
platform.
4003 to
4004
Revision
This two-word data area contains the text values for the revision
number.
4005 to
4006
Op Sys #
This two-word data area contains the text values for the operating
system number.
4007 to
4008
Run Number
This two-word data area contains the text values for the run number.
4009
Read Blk Cnt
This word contains the total number of block read operations
successfully executed.
4010
Write Blk Cnt
This word contains the total number of block write operations
successfully executed.
4011
Parse Blk Cnt
This word contains the total number of write blocks successfully
parsed.
4012
Error Blk Cnt
This word contains the total number of block transfer errors.
4013
Event Msg Cnt This word contains the number of event messages waiting to send to
the processor.
4014
Event Msg
Overflow
This word contains a value of 0 if the event message buffer has not
overflowed. If the event buffer overflows, this word will be set to a value
of 1.
4015
Session Count This word contains the number of session configured in the module.
4016 Current
Cmd
This word contains the index of the current command being executed
in the command list.
4017
Cmd Busy Flag This word is set to zero if no command is currently being executed and
waiting on a response. If the word is set to 1, a command is currently
executing.
4018 Cmd
Count This word contains the count of the number of commands configured
for the module.
4019 Cmd
Delay This word contains the command delay counter preset. There is a fixed
delay between each command to permit the module to perform class
polls on controlled stations.
4020 Cmd
Queue
This word is set to zero if the command executing is from the
command list. If the executing command is from the command queue,
the word will be set to 1.
